Indomitable in Asia

Asian ADR issuers aren't afraid of Sox.

Sarbanes-Oxley may be a cloud hanging over a lot of foreign issuers on US exchanges, but Asia seems hardly to have noticed. Sox certainly didn’t deter the ten Chinese tech stocks that listed American depositary receipts (ADRs) on Nasdaq in the year to September, or the dozen or so still in the pipeline. Section 404 didn’t scare off one of the largest ever venture cap-backed IPOs, Shanghai chip maker SMIC, which last year dual-listed in Hong Kong and on the NYSE, raising $1.8 bn
